MongoDB 學習筆記2----條件操做符

條件操做符:用於兩個比較兩個表達式並從mongdb中獲取文檔javascript

mongodb常見的操做符及解析說明java

$lt:小於
example:ago<20
$lte:小於等於
example:<=20
$gt:大於
example: ago>10
$gte:大於等於
example:ago>=10

mongodb使用示例mongodb

1查詢user集合中ago大於10的文檔blog

db.user.find({"ago":{$gt:10}}).

輸出內容ip

{ "_id" : ObjectId("574e680a308dfae5b2b0a357"), "name" : "zhangsan", "password" : "123456", "ago" : 20 }

 2查詢user集合中ago大於等於10,小於等於30的文檔文檔

db.user.find({"ago":{$gte:10,$lte:30}})

輸出內容class

{ "_id" : ObjectId("574e680a308dfae5b2b0a357"), "name" : "zhangsan", "password" : "123456", "ago" : 20 }

 3查詢user集合中ago大於等於10,小於等於30,且score大於70的文檔,查詢

db.user.find({"ago":{$gte:10,$lte:30},"score":{$gt:80}})
相關文章
相關標籤/搜索